Description:   Opened: 2004-02-05 09:22 0000
As seen on Planet Gnome and http://www.gnome.org/~markmc/blog/

May need some work to separate the client (requires java <yuk>) and the server components, but it works for now.

(well, almost - you'll have to do a lsof -c vino-server to work out what port it's actually listening on)

Ebuild and patch for compile error to follow.

------- Comment #6 From foser (RETIRED) 2004-03-03 01:32:44 0000 -------
@ the ebuild, the libbonobo dep tricks aren't really necessary, just depend on
libbonobo alone -> it always implies bonobo-activation if needed.

let src_unpack & SRC_URI be handled by the gnome2 eclass.
